The recent flood of cheap steel imports has presented a severe challenge to the [Country Name]'s steel industry. Producers have struggled to compete with prices significantly undercut by foreign manufacturers, often due to allegations of dumping – the practice of selling goods below cost in a foreign market to gain market share. This practice, coupled with government subsidies in exporting nations, creates an uneven playing field, threatening the viability of domestic steel mills and related businesses.
The impact extends beyond the immediate steel sector. Thousands of jobs are directly and indirectly linked to the industry, including those in manufacturing, construction, and transportation. A weakening steel industry translates to job losses, reduced tax revenue, and a potential domino effect across the broader economy. While the steel safeguards are primarily designed to protect domestic producers, they will also have implications for consumers and businesses. The increased price of imported steel may lead to slightly higher prices for steel-related products, such as construction materials and automobiles. However, the government argues that the long-term benefits of a healthy domestic steel industry, including job security and economic stability, outweigh these potential short-term cost increases. Moreover, the safeguards aim to foster fair competition, ensuring that domestic producers can compete effectively without being undercut by unfairly priced imports.
